Logo image of IMB.L

IMPERIAL BRANDS PLC (IMB.L) Stock Chart

Europe - London Exchange - LON:IMB - GB0004544929 - Common Stock

3002 GBX
-11 (-0.37%)
Last: 1/23/2026, 3:10:37 PM
Open in Chart Tool
IMPERIAL BRANDS PLC / IMB Daily stock chart